On Feb. 10, 2009 I paid $1595 for residential loan modification negotiation services. As of April 2 they have not delivered any negotiation package to my lender. Their website is now down and no one is answering any of the various phone numbers for Diener Law Firm or Home Relief Services.

Under Consumer Protection>Consumer Information> Credit and Loans>mortgages Excerpt from the FTC website - there is more there READ IT AND PROTECT YOURSELF! Phony Counseling or Phantom Help The scam artist tells you that he can negotiate a deal with your lender to save your house if you pay a fee first. You may be told not to contact your lender, lawyer, or credit counselor, and to let the scam artist handle all the details. Once you pay the fee, the scam artist takes off with your money. Sometimes, the scam artist insists that you make all mortgage payments directly to him while he negotiates with the lender. In this instance, the scammer may collect a few months of payments before disappearing.
